随着移动互联网的普及,响应式网页设计已成为现代网页开发的必然趋势。
在响应式网页设计中,下拉菜单作为一种常见的导航元素,对于提升用户体验和提高网站可用性具有重要作用。
下拉菜单在响应式网页设计中的实践与设置并非一件简单的事情,需要结合用户需求、设备特性和浏览器兼容性等多方面因素进行综合考虑。
本文将详细探讨下拉菜单在响应式网页设计中的实践与设置。
下拉菜单作为一种导航元素,在响应式网页设计中扮演着重要角色。
下拉菜单可以隐藏冗余的导航菜单项,只展示主要的菜单项,使网页结构更加简洁明了。
下拉菜单可以在用户交互时展示更多的选项,为用户提供更多的选择。
下拉菜单还可以适应不同屏幕尺寸和设备,实现响应式设计,提高网站的可用性和用户体验。
1. 需求分析:在设计下拉菜单之前,需要进行充分的需求分析,了解用户的需求和行为习惯,以便设计出符合用户期望的下拉菜单。
2. 设计原则:下拉菜单的设计应遵循简洁、清晰、易于操作的原则。菜单项应合理分组,以便用户快速找到所需内容。
3. 交互设计:下拉菜单的交互方式应简单明了,用户无需进行复杂的操作即可实现导航。常见的交互方式包括点击、悬停等。
4. 适配不同设备:下拉菜单应能适应不同屏幕尺寸和设备,如手机、平板、桌面等,以确保在各种设备上都能良好地工作。
1. HTML结构:下拉菜单的HTML结构应简洁明了,便于维护和修改。常见的HTML结构包括无序列表(ul)、有序列表(ol)和选择框(select)等。
2. CSS样式:通过CSS样式,可以实现对下拉菜单的样式设计,如颜色、字体、背景等。还需要通过CSS实现下拉菜单的隐藏和显示效果。
3. 响应式设计:为了实现下拉菜单的响应式设计,需要使用媒体查询(Media Query)等技术,根据设备屏幕尺寸和分辨率进行适配。
4. JavaScript交互:通过JavaScript实现下拉菜单的交互功能,如点击菜单项时的响应、下拉菜单的展开和收起等。
1. 挑战:在响应式网页设计中实现下拉菜单时,可能会面临浏览器兼容性问题、触摸设备支持问题、菜单动画性能问题等挑战。
2. 解决方案:为了解决这个问题,需要关注不同浏览器的兼容性,使用前缀或回退方案;同时,需要关注触摸设备的支持,提供触摸友好的交互方式;还需要优化菜单动画性能,提高用户体验。
以某电商网站为例,该网站采用了响应式下拉菜单设计,以适应不同设备和屏幕尺寸。
通过媒体查询实现菜单的响应式布局,使用JavaScript实现菜单的交互功能。
在实际应用中,该网站的下拉菜单表现出良好的性能和用户体验,提高了网站的可用性和转化率。
下拉菜单在响应式网页设计中具有重要的应用价值。
在设计与设置过程中,需要充分考虑用户需求、设备特性和浏览器兼容性等多方面因素。
通过实践中的不断调整和优化,可以设计出符合用户期望、具有良好用户体验的下拉菜单,提高网站的可用性和转化率。
本文地址:http://www.hyyidc.com/article/162667.html
上一篇:网页开发中如何运用CSS和JavaScript设置下...
下一篇:网页导航菜单优化下拉菜单设置技巧探讨网页...